Kandice Mae Smith Obituary

It is with deep sorrow that we announce the death of Kandice Mae Smith of Birmingham, Ohio, born in Oberlin, Ohio, who passed away on January 26, 2022, at the age of 23, leaving to mourn family and friends. She was predeceased by: her grandparents, Robert Clark, Richard Morton and Fawn Smith. She is survived by: her parents, Rebecca Smith of Birmingham and Steven Smith of Vermilion; her sisters, Karli Hibinger (Michael) of Westlake, Kelli Smith (Darin Adamson) of Elyria and Kaci Smith; her nephew Robert Adamson; her niece Janina Adamson; her grandmother Reva Morton of Alabama; her stepgrandmother Carol Clark; her grandparents, Walter Smith of South Amherst and Barb Smith of South Amherst; and her caregivers, Louise, Diane, Cindy and Kandice.
